How to Reach Reussen in Germany

Reussen is a charming village located in Germany, offering a peaceful and picturesque retreat for visitors. If you are planning a trip to Reussen, here are some ways to reach this beautiful destination:

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Reussen is Leipzig/Halle Airport, which is approximately 70 kilometers away. From the airport, you can easily hire a taxi or rent a car to reach Reussen. Alternatively, you can also take a train from Leipzig to the nearest train station to Reussen.

By Train:

Reussen has good rail connectivity, and you can reach the village by train from various cities in Germany. The nearest major train station to Reussen is in Leipzig. From Leipzig, you can take a regional train to Reussen, which usually takes around 1 hour. Trains in Germany are known for their efficiency and comfort, making it a convenient option for travelers.

By Car:

If you prefer driving, Reussen is easily accessible by car. The village is located close to the A9 Autobahn, which connects major cities in Germany. From Leipzig, you can take the A38 and then merge onto the A9 towards Berlin. Take the exit towards Reussen, and follow the signs to reach the village. The scenic countryside drive will add to the overall experience of your journey.

By Bus:

Reussen is well-connected by bus services from neighboring towns and cities. You can check the local bus schedules and routes to plan your journey accordingly. Buses in Germany are reliable and offer a cost-effective mode of transportation.
